Allen-Bradley 6180 Industrial Computers typically use interrupt level 9
(IRQ9) for the touchscreen controller hardware. By traditional PC
convention, IRQ 9 is unused by system board hardware and therefore is
made available to ISA add-in cards. However, some recent system
boards, such as Intel’s SE440BX (Seattle) motherboard, automatically
reserve IRQ 9 for system board functions (such as power management).
Because of this, the touchscreen controller hardware in your computer,
as well as the touchscreen software drivers, have been changed to
support reconfiguration of the selected IRQ. This is sometimes referred
to as “interrupt steering”.

Newer versions of the touchscreen software will auto-detect the type of
system board installed in your computer. Based on the system board’s
interrupt requirements, the software will either:

leave the selected interrupt at the power on configuration (IRQ 9)

or “steer” the interrupt to some other unused IRQ level to avoid
resource conflicts.

The IRQ configuration conforms to the following table.

System Configuration

System Board Type

IRQ

6180-Axxxxxxxxxxxx Advanced/ML

(Marl) 9

6180-Bxxxxxxxxxxxx

Advanced/ML w/MMX
(Marl MMX)

9

6180-Cxxxxxxxxxxxx PD440FX (Portland)

9

6180-Dxxxxxxxxxxxx SE440BX (Seattle)

5

For computers without a touchscreen, no IRO is selected
